Despite 100 years of failure, violating some of the 6 key lessons on enacting health care reform legislation, and multiple near-death experiences, March 23, 2010, was historic. Maybe the vice president put it most succinctly:

“This is a big f***ing deal.”

But it wasn’t the end of the fight. Immediately after President Obama signed the ACA, lawsuits were filed to block it. Before it could even be implemented, the US Supreme Court would have its say.

= CHAPTER SEVEN =

What the Supreme Court Said

The Constitutionality of the Affordable Care Act

The passage of the Affordable Care Act was filled with drama: the drama of the August 2009 recess, when representatives and senators were attacked by Tea Party opponents of reform; the drama of the Senate’s Christmas Eve vote for the ACA, in which Majority Leader Reid mistakenly voted to oppose the Senate’s bill; the drama of Vice President Biden whispering the famous expletive to President Obama at the signing of the act.

As though this were not enough, the drama continued with 3 days of Supreme Court arguments in March 2012, and then the ultimate drama of June 28, 2012, when the Court ruled. And the drama was further heightened by CNN’s mistake in trying to be the first to report the Court’s decision—but calling it wrong. Their call stopped hearts and sowed confusion for 10 minutes or more until the real facts could be circulated.

Ultimately, the Court ruled that the ACA was constitutional as an application of Congress’s power to tax. It also created a complication for rolling out the Medicaid expansion, limiting the powers the federal government can use to persuade states to adopt certain policies.

But how did the ACA get to the Court in the first place?
